Hadron vertices in composite superstring model
V.A.Kudryavtsev (Petersburg Nuclear Physics Institute)

Abstract
Hadron vertices for u, d, s quark flavours are formulated in terms of interacting composite strings. The vertices for emission of pi, K mesons and nucleons are presented.
